## Product: Ray-Ban Wayfarer Glasses
**Brand:** Ray-Ban Meta

## Pros
- Classic Ray-Ban style with a durable, stylish design that doesn't scream "tech gadget"
- Good camera quality with effective image stabilization, capturing sharp photos and smooth videos
- Open-ear audio system delivers clear sound during calls and media consumption
- Long battery life, supporting a full day of use, with a portable charging case for extra power
- Seamless voice control with Meta AI, allowing hands-free commands and media control
- Looks like regular sunglasses, making them discreet for everyday wear
- Quick, straightforward setup that integrates smoothly with devices
- Comfortable fit for extended wear, ideal for active lifestyles
- Reliable Bluetooth connectivity with various devices
- Great gift option for fitness enthusiasts or tech lovers

## Cons
- Video recording is limited to 5-minute clips, which may be restrictive for some users
- The blinking LED during recording can be distracting and raises privacy concerns
- The app is somewhat basic and can be finicky with video syncing and management
- Not waterproof, so careful use around water is necessary
- No microSD card slot, meaning footage must be transferred via phone, which can be inconvenient
- Slight discomfort noted due to the weight, feeling heavier on the nose than ears for some
- Still room for hardware and software improvements, particularly in camera features and privacy indicators
- Lighting conditions significantly impact photo and video quality

## Bottom Line

The Meta Ray-Ban Wayfarer Glasses blend iconic style with modern smart tech, offering decent camera performance, good audio, and reliable hands-free control. They're perfect if you want discreet, fashionable glasses that double as a smart camera and speaker system, especially for casual or active use. However, the limited video clip length and privacy LED might bother some users, and software quirks could be improved. If you’re seeking a more advanced or water-resistant option, you may want to consider a dedicated action camera or smart glasses with longer recording capabilities.
